The men pick up two engineering sergeants and two frightened young Once Henry’s damaged leg has healed, the army grants him A Farewell to Arms is a novel by American writer Ernest Hemingway, set during the Italian campaign of World War I.First published in 1929, it is a first-person account of an American, Frederic Henry, serving as a lieutenant ("tenente") in the ambulance corps of the Italian Army.The title is taken from a poem by the 16th-century English dramatist George Peele.
